Gravida - CORRECT ANSWER-# of pregnancies
True Labor - CORRECT ANSWER-Cervical Change & Contractions
Para - CORRECT ANSWER-# of viable pregnancies (>20 weeks)
False Labor - CORRECT ANSWER-Braxton Hicks contractions
Nullgravida - CORRECT ANSWER-Never pregnant
Primigravida - CORRECT ANSWER-Pregnant or one chile
Multigravida - CORRECT ANSWER-Pregnant second or more times
,Ovulation - CORRECT ANSWER-Occurs 14 days before next
menstruation
Mature Ovum - CORRECT ANSWER-Live 12-24 hours then starts to
degenerate
Sperm - CORRECT ANSWER-Lives up to 5 days in female system
Naegeles Rule - CORRECT ANSWER-add 7 days to LMP, subtract 3
months, add 1 year
Term - CORRECT ANSWER-Delivery at 37 to 42 weeks
Preterm - CORRECT ANSWER-Delivery after 20 weeks- 36 weeks 6/7
days
Abortion - CORRECT ANSWER-Delivery before 20 weeks
Human Chorionic Gonadotropin (hCG) - CORRECT ANSWER-Maintain
corpus leteum
In urine & serum 10 to 14 days after conception
, Human Placental Lactogen (hPL) - CORRECT ANSWER-Insulin
antagonist by placenta increase blood glucose
Estrogen - CORRECT ANSWER-Vasodilation, changes sensitivity of
respiratory system to carbon dioxide
Softens cervix, initiate uterine activity, maintain labor
Develops breasts for lactation, secretion of prolactin
